The true value lies in the delivery format. Each illustration is saved separately as both PNG and JPEG files at 8 inches and 300 DPI (2400 pixels). For the uninitiated, this resolution is the gold standard for premium quality. The 300 DPI ensures that your prints are crisp and free from pixelation, while the generous pixel width allows for significant scaling without immediate degradation. The PNG files feature transparent backgrounds, making them indispensable for layering over textures, colored backgrounds, or within complex packaging design. The JPEG versions offer a universal compatibility that ensures these assets open seamlessly in virtually any image program, from advanced Adobe suites to basic mobile editing apps.

Design Psychology and Brand Perception
Choosing an illustration style is not merely an aesthetic choice; it is a psychological one. The use of character-based graphics, like those found in the Baby Monster Illustrations pack, significantly influences audience engagement.
Humans are wired to respond to faces and anthropomorphic features. By incorporating these monsters into your brand identity, you are leveraging this psychological trigger to foster trust and emotional connection. Unlike generic icons or abstract shapes, a character provides a narrative anchor. It gives your brand a "face," making it more memorable. However, it is crucial to maintain visual hierarchy. These illustrations are bold and engaging; they should be used to guide the viewer’s eye, not distract from the core message. Pairing them with clean, legible typography—such as a modern sans serif font—often creates the best balance, ensuring the text remains the priority while the illustrations add flavor.
Practical Guidance for Integration
To get the most out of this asset pack, a strategic approach to integration is necessary. Here is how to ensure these illustrations work for your specific needs:
- Evaluating Fit: Before committing to a design direction, map out your color palette. While the monsters are provided with transparent backgrounds, consider how their inherent colors interact with your brand’s primary and secondary hues. If the monsters are vibrant, your background might need to be neutral to avoid visual clashing.
- Font Pairing: The whimsical nature of these monsters pairs surprisingly well with structured typography. Try combining them with a geometric sans serif font for a modern look, or a clean serif font for a more traditional, storybook feel. Avoid overly complex script fonts or handwritten fonts that might compete with the illustration's detail.
